Manchester Arndale is seeking a Cleaner in Northampton to maintain clean and safe environments for customers. The role involves tidying work areas, sweeping, vacuuming, and completing necessary Health & Safety records.
The ideal candidate should have the right to work in the UK and possess attention to detail. This position follows a 5-day working pattern per week from 06:00 to 14:00.
OCS promotes an inclusive workforce and encourages applications from individuals of diverse backgrounds.
